jsp制作学生成绩管理系统
时间: 2023-09-10 16:15:56 浏览: 96
学生成绩管理系统是一个比较典型的管理系统,实现起来比较复杂。如果你要使用JSP来实现,需要掌握一些前置知识,例如Java Servlet和JSP的基础知识,以及MySQL数据库的基本操作等。
下面是一个简单的学生成绩管理系统的实现步骤:
1. 创建数据库表:首先需要创建一个数据库表,用于存储学生信息和成绩信息。表中需要包含学生姓名、学号、班级、课程名称、成绩等字段。
2. 创建Java Bean:为了方便操作数据,需要创建一个Java Bean,用于封装学生和成绩的信息。这个Bean需要与数据库表对应。
3. 创建DAO层:在DAO层中,需要编写一些代码来连接数据库,并实现数据的增删改查操作。这里可以使用JDBC来完成。
4. 创建Servlet:在Servlet中,需要调用DAO层的代码,获取数据库中的数据,并通过request对象将数据传递给JSP页面。
5. 创建JSP页面:在JSP页面中,可以使用JSTL和EL表达式等技术,将从Servlet中获取的数据展示在页面上。同时,还需要编写一些JavaScript代码,实现数据的动态展示和交互。
总的来说,学生成绩管理系统的实现比较复杂,需要掌握多个技术点。如果你是初学者,建议先从基础开始学习,逐步深入。
相关问题
jsp制作学生成绩管理系统获取数据进行数据检测
首先需要明确你是想从哪里获取数据。如果是从数据库中获取数据,那么你需要编写JSP代码来连接数据库,查询需要的数据。接下来,你可以使用Java代码对获取到的数据进行检测。
具体实现方法如下:
1. 连接数据库:使用JDBC连接数据库,获取数据库连接对象。
2. 查询数据:使用SQL语句查询需要的数据,并将查询结果保存到ResultSet对象中。
3. 检测数据:使用Java代码对ResultSet对象中的数据进行检测,例如判断成绩是否符合要求等。
4. 显示数据:将检测通过的数据显示在页面上,可以使用JSP或者Servlet来实现。
需要注意的是,为了保证数据的安全性,建议在JSP页面中使用JSTL标签库来显示数据,避免XSS攻击等安全问题。同时,对于用户提交的数据,也需要进行严格的检测和过滤,以防止SQL注入等攻击。
阅读全文